- 1、本文档共28页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
毕业设计(论文)
PAGE
1-
毕业设计(论文)报告
题目:
关于进制和转换的体会
学号:
姓名:
学院:
专业:
指导教师:
起止日期:
关于进制和转换的体会
摘要:本文从进制的基本概念出发,探讨了不同进制之间的转换方法及其应用。首先,介绍了二进制、八进制、十进制和十六进制等常见进制系统,分析了它们各自的特点和适用场景。接着,详细阐述了进制转换的原理和方法,包括位权展开法、除基取余法等。通过实际案例,验证了进制转换的正确性和实用性。最后,对进制转换在计算机科学、通信技术等领域的应用进行了分析,总结了进制转换在现代社会中的重要作用。本文旨在为读者提供全面、系统的进制转换知识,为相关领域的研究和实践提供参考。
随着计算机科学和信息技术的发展,进制转换在各个领域中的应用越来越广泛。进制是数学和计算机科学中的一种表示方法,它能够有效地表示和处理信息。本文旨在通过对进制和转换的研究,揭示进制转换的原理和方法,探讨其在实际应用中的重要性。首先,本文简要介绍了进制的基本概念,包括二进制、八进制、十进制和十六进制等。接着,详细阐述了进制转换的原理和方法,分析了不同进制之间的转换过程。最后,对进制转换在计算机科学、通信技术等领域的应用进行了探讨,以期为相关领域的研究和实践提供参考。
第一章进制概述
1.1进制的概念
(1)进制,又称数制,是用于计数和表达数值的一种系统。它是基于数学运算中的一种规则,通过一组固定的数字和基数(基数是系统中允许使用的数字个数)来表示数值。在不同的进制系统中,基数的选择决定了数字的表达方式。例如,在十进制系统中,基数是10,因此使用了0到9这十个数字来表示所有的数值。而在二进制系统中,基数是2,只使用0和1两个数字进行计数。
(2)进制的概念起源于古埃及的算术,后来逐渐演变成今天我们所熟悉的数制。在计算机科学中,二进制是最基本的进制,因为计算机硬件使用的是基于二进制的逻辑电路。二进制系统的简单性使得计算机能够精确地执行逻辑运算和存储信息。在二进制中,每一位只能表示两种状态:0或1,这正好与开关电路的开和关相对应。这种二进制表示方法使得计算机的硬件设计更加简单和可靠。
(3)进制之间的转换是理解和应用进制系统的基础。例如,将十进制数转换为二进制数,通常是通过不断地除以基数2,并记录下余数来实现的。这个过程称为位权展开法。另一种方法是除基取余法,它通过从最高位开始,依次除以目标进制(如从十进制转换为二进制)的基数,并记录每次的余数来得到目标进制表示。进制转换不仅限于二进制和十进制之间,还包括八进制、十六进制等多种进制之间的转换。掌握这些转换方法对于理解计算机科学和电子工程等领域的原理至关重要。
1.2常见进制系统
(1)二进制是计算机科学中最基本的进制系统,它的基数是2,使用0和1两个数字来表示所有的数值。二进制系统与计算机硬件紧密相关,因为电子设备中的开关电路只能有两种状态:开和关,这恰好与二进制的两个数字相对应。在二进制中,每一位的值由该位的位置决定,称为位权。例如,二进制数1011中的最右边位代表1,第二位代表2,第三位代表4,最左边位代表8。
(2)十进制是我们日常使用最广泛的进制系统,其基数是10,使用了0到9这十个数字。在十进制中,数值的大小通过数字的位置和位权来决定。例如,数值123可以分解为1×102+2×101+3×10?。十进制系统便于人们理解和计算,因为它是基于我们手指的数量,也与人类的计数习惯相符合。
(3)八进制和十六进制是两种在计算机科学中常见的进制系统。八进制使用0到7这八个数字,基数是8,它简化了二进制到十进制的转换,因为每三位二进制数可以直接转换为一位八进制数。十六进制使用0到9以及A到F这十六个数字,基数是16,它进一步简化了二进制到十进制的转换,因为每四位二进制数可以直接转换为一位十六进制数。这两种进制在计算机编程和数字通信中广泛应用,尤其是在表示大数值时,十六进制因其简洁性而尤为受欢迎。
1.3进制的应用
(1)进制的应用在计算机科学中尤为广泛,其中二进制是计算机硬件和软件设计的基础。例如,在计算机内存中,所有的数据都是以二进制形式存储和处理的。以2020年为例,全球计算机内存的容量达到了数十亿GB,这些内存芯片中的每一位都是通过二进制位(bit)来存储信息的。在处理这些数据时,二进制使得计算机能够进行精确的位运算,如AND、OR、NOT等,这些都是计算机体系结构中不可或缺的部分。
(2)进制转换在通信技术中也发挥着重要作用。例如,在无线通信中,数字信号需要被调制到特定的频率上,以便在信道中传输。这一过程中,十进制到二进制的转换是必要的,因为调制解调器(modem)通常以二进制形式处理信号。根据
文档评论(0)